Where does “kriseh” come from?
kriseh (Kristang) comes from Portuguese crescer, from Old Portuguese crecer, from Latin crēscō, from Proto-Italic krēskō, from Proto-Indo-European ḱer-, from Proto-Indo-European kr̥-, from Proto-Indo-European ker- — army.
kriseh (Kristang): grow
